- The British Labour Party in Opposition, 1979-1997: Structures, Agency, and Party ChangeAllan, James P. (Virginia Tech, 1997-04-24)The British Labour Party has spent eighteen years in opposition since 1979. During that time it lost four consecutive general elections to the Conservative Party. In 1997, however, it now looks set to win its first election since 1974. This thesis examines the Labour Party in opposition since 1979, using a theoretical framework informed by Anthony Giddens' structuration theory. Based on a dialectical notion of the structure and agency linkage, a two-tiered framework is constructed which at one level views a political party as consisting of a set of structures which can constrain and enable party leaders in their attempts to make the party electorally successful, and at another level the party is regarded as a collective agent in its own right, which in turn is subject to the effects of larger external structures. By comparing the strategies adopted by the Labour Party and its leaders since 1979, the thesis demonstrates that the apparent recovery in the Party's electoral fortunes has corresponded with an increase in the ability of agents to successfully negotiate structural constraints, whilst taking advantage of enabling structures. However, it is also clear that the transformation of Labour into an electorally viable party in 1997 is not solely the product of agency in the period since the last election; rather, it is the culmination of a longer-term process of party change.
- Czechoslovakia: A State of Perceived BiasSeiler, Danielle M.S. (Virginia Tech, 1998-04-28)This thesis explores the circumstances behind the dissolution of the state of Czechoslovakia. Unlike previous works, this paper contends that the Velvet Divorce was not simply a result of the expulsion of Communism, but rather the end product of a multitude of forces, both interior and exterior to the state's boundaries. The transition from Communism was merely the catalyst. In examining the attitudinal and eventual physical division between the majority of Czechs and Slovaks, this paper extends the criteria for consensus articulated by George Schöpflin (1993) into the context of Czechoslovakia. Schöpflin contends that support for the state in the post-Communist period is based on three characteristics: faith in the nation, belief in economic reform, and hatred for all things Communist. This thesis contends that most Czechs and Slovaks in Czechoslovakia were divided on the basis of whether they believed that their nation's right to self-determination had been fulfilled, whether they advocated more socialist or capitalist policies, and whether they benefitted from the experience of Communism. These fundamental differences contributed to the failure to reach agreement in 1992 concerning the shape of the "new" or "revived" Czechoslovakia. Furthermore, this paper will show that the Velvet Divorce was not merely a product of internal disagreements. The creation, existence, and even dissolution of the state were influenced by global forces. Events such as the French Revolution, World War II, and even the Independence of Croatia had an impact in Czechoslovakia. The state was not born into a bubble; its borders were chronically permeable.
- A Design Methodology for Physical Design for TestabilityAlmajdoub, Salahuddin A. (Virginia Tech, 1996-07-01)Physical design for testability (PDFT) is a strategy to design circuits in a way to avoid or reduce realistic physical faults. The goal of this work is to define and establish a speci c methodology for PDFT. The proposed design methodology includes techniques to reduce potential bridging faults in complementary metal-oxide-semiconductor (CMOS) circuits. To compare faults, the design process utilizes a new parameter called the fault index. The fault index for a particular fault is the probability of occurrence of the fault divided by the testability of the fault. Faults with the highest fault indices are considered the worst faults and are targeted by the PDFT design process to eliminate them or reduce their probability of occurrence. An implementation of the PDFT design process is constructed using several new tools in addition to other "off-the-shelf" tools. The first tool developed in this work is a testability measure tool for bridging faults. Two other tools are developed to eliminate or reduce the probability of occurrence of bridging faults with high fault indices. The row enhancer targets faults inside the logic elements of the circuit, while the channel enhancer targets faults inside the routing part of the circuit. To demonstrate the capabilities and test the eff ectiveness of the PDFT design process, this work conducts an experiment which includes designing three CMOS circuits from the ISCAS 1985 benchmark circuits. Several layouts are generated for every circuit. Every layout, except the rst one, utilizes information from the previous layout to minimize the probability of occurrence for faults with high fault indices. Experimental results show that the PDFT design process successfully achieves two goals of PDFT, providing layouts with fewer faults and minimizing the probability of occurrence of hard-to-test faults. Improvement in the total fault index was about 40 percent in some cases, while improvement in total critical area was about 30 percent in some cases. However, virtually all the improvements came from using the row enhancer; the channel enhancer provided only marginal improvements.
